MBA in Dubai Cost

An MBA in Dubai typically costs between AED 50,000 to AED 180,000 (≈ ₹11.2 Lakhs to ₹40.5 Lakhs) for total tuition, depending on the school and program. Factoring in living expenses, visas, and health insurance, total yearly costs generally range from AED 75,000 to AED 220,000 (≈ ₹19.78 lakh – ₹58.01 lakh).  

MBA in Dubai cost usually includes tuition fees, accommodation, food, transport, visa, Emirates ID, health insurance, books, application fees, and personal expenses.

Average Cost of MBA in Dubai 

The average cost of MBA in Dubai depends on university type, course duration, credit structure, and program format. Some universities charge per credit, while others show full program fees. Students should compare total tuition, VAT, living expenses, visa, and hidden charges before finalising any university. 

Average MBA Tuition Fees in Dubai by Program Type 

MBA fees differ in Dubai because universities offer standard MBA, executive MBA, global MBA, and specialized MBA options. International branch campuses often charge more due to their global curriculum, flexible formats, access to international faculty, and exposure to strong business networks.   

The table below shows average tuition fees by MBA type in Dubai. 

MBA Type 

Common Duration 

Approx. Tuition Cost with INR (Approx.) 

Standard MBA 

1–2 years 

AED 65,000–AED 105,000 (≈ ₹17.10 lakh–₹27.62 lakh) 

Executive MBA 

1–2 years 

AED 72,600–AED 135,000+ (≈ ₹19.09 lakh–₹35.50 lakh+) 

Global MBA 

Around 12 months 

Around USD 44,020 (≈ 42.66 lakh) 

Affordable MBA 

Around 1 year 

AED 65,000–AED 85,000 (≈ ₹17.10 lakh–₹22.35 lakh) 

Premium MBA 

1–2 years 

AED 100,000–AED 132,000+ (≈ ₹26.30 lakh–₹34.72 lakh+) 

Sources: Official University Websites.  

  • SP Jain lists USD 44,020 as total compulsory fees for its Global MBA. 

  • Amity Dubai lists MBA fees at AED 2,200 per credit for 30 credits.

MBA in Dubai Cost at Top Universities 

Dubai has MBA options from UAE-based universities and international branch campuses. Students should compare tuition fees with accreditation, career support, class schedule, location, alumni network, and employer access before applying. For tuition fees, refer to official university websites because costs can change based on intake and may include VAT or other charges.   

The table below highlights MBA fees at popular universities in Dubai. 

University / Business School 

MBA Program Details 

Tuition Fee with INR (Approx.) 

Canadian University Dubai 

MBA, 36 credits 

AED 101,115 (≈ ₹26.59 lakh) 

Middlesex University Dubai 

MBA Daytime, 1 year full-time / 2 years part-time 

AED 84,872 (≈ ₹22.32 lakh) 

Heriot-Watt University Dubai 

MBA with Specialism in Professional Practice 

Fee varies by intake; premium MBA option 

Amity University Dubai 

MBA, 1 year, 30 credits 

AED 66,000 (≈ ₹17.36 lakh) 

SP Jain School of Global Management 

Global MBA, Singapore + Dubai format 

USD 44,020 (≈ ₹42.66 lakh) 

Cost of Living in Dubai for MBA Students 

Living expenses are a key part of the total cost of an MBA in Dubai. It can be costly if you choose private accommodation, taxis, frequently eat out, and opt for premium lifestyle options. Students can lower costs by sharing housing, using public transport, cooking at home, and budgeting wisely. 

Monthly Living Expenses in Dubai 

Your monthly expenses depend on rent, location, transport, food habits, and lifestyle. Areas near academic campuses or metro routes may save time, but may not always be the cheapest. Rent is usually the biggest monthly expense for MBA students in Dubai. 

The table below gives an estimated monthly budget for MBA students in Dubai. 

Expense Category 

What It Covers 

Approx. Monthly Cost with INR 

Food and Groceries 

Meals, groceries, basic supplies 

AED 1,000–AED 1,800 (≈ ₹26,300–₹47,340) 

Rent and Utilities 

Shared room, studio, utilities 

AED 2,500–AED 7,000 (≈ ₹65,750–₹1.84 lakh) 

Transport 

Metro, bus, taxi, local travel 

AED 300–AED 800 (≈ ₹7,890–₹21,040) 

Phone and Internet 

Mobile plan and internet share 

AED 150–AED 400 (≈ ₹3,945–₹10,520) 

Personal Expenses 

Laundry, clothing, basic shopping 

AED 500–AED 1,000 (≈ ₹13,150–₹26,300) 

Average Living Cost 

Single person, excluding rent 

Around AED 4,240 (≈ ₹1.11 lakh) 

Sources: Numbeo 

Accommodation Cost in Dubai 

Accommodation can change your total MBA budget significantly. Shared housing is usually more affordable than a private studio. Students should also check security deposit, utilities, internet, cooling charges, and commute cost before finalising accommodation. 

The table below compares common accommodation options for MBA students in Dubai. 

Accommodation Type 

Cost Impact 

Best For 

Shared Apartment 

Lower rent and shared bills 

Budget-conscious students 

Private Studio 

Higher rent and privacy 

Students with higher budget 

University Accommodation 

Convenient but limited 

Students who want campus access 

Room in Family Apartment 

Moderate cost and basic facilities 

Students looking for stable housing 

Sources: Numbeo 

Scholarships to Reduce MBA in Dubai Cost 

Scholarships can reduce the Cost of study MBA in Dubai, but they are usually competitive and may depend on academic record, work experience, nationality, merit, alumni status, or corporate partnerships. Apply early because some scholarships are linked with admission rounds and fee deadlines. 

University-Based Scholarships 

Many Dubai universities offer discounts, merit scholarships, alumni discounts, corporate partner discounts, and early payment benefits. These may reduce tuition fees, but they may not cover visa, rent, books, insurance, or living expenses. Always check scholarship terms before calculating your final budget. 

The table below shows common scholarship and discount options. 

Scholarship / Discount Type 

Who Can Apply 

Coverage 

Merit Scholarship 

Strong academic profile 

Partial tuition reduction 

Alumni Discount 

Previous students of same university 

Partial fee discount 

Corporate Partner Discount 

Employees of partner companies 

Tuition discount 

Early Payment Discount 

Students paying early 

Limited fee reduction 

Need-Based Support 

Students with financial need 

Varies by university 

Sources: Official University Websites

How to Plan MBA in Dubai Cost Smartly 

Planning MBA in Dubai cost early can help you avoid budget pressure after admission. Compare tuition, rent, visa cost, scholarships, payment plans, commute, and career support before choosing a university. Dubai is close to India, but living expenses can still be high if you do not budget properly. 

Follow these steps to plan your MBA budget: 

  1. Shortlist universities based on tuition fees and career goals. 

  1. Check official university fee pages for the latest MBA fee. 

  1. Confirm whether tuition includes VAT, registration, and incidental fees. 

  1. Add monthly rent and living expenses for the full course duration. 

  1. Ask the university about visa, insurance, and Emirates ID costs. 

  1. Compare scholarships, alumni discounts, and payment plans. 

  1. Keep an emergency fund for at least 3–6 months. 

  1. Compare salary scope with your total investment before applying. 

Note: A good budget should include tuition, rent, food, transport, visa, insurance, books, travel, and emergency savings.
